Homofermentative Arten produzieren aus Glucose durch Gärung praktisch ausschließlich Milchsäure, während heterofermentative Arten neben Milchsäure zu einem bedeutenden Teil auch andere Endprodukte erzeugen, meist Ethanol und Kohlenstoffdioxid, manchmal auch Essigsäure. [7], Als Vertreter der Milchsäurebakterien wachsen Laktobazillen anaerob, aber aerotolerant, d. h., sie wachsen in der Anwesenheit von Luftsauerstoff, benötigen aber keinen Sauerstoff für ihren Stoffwechsel. Lactobacillus species are normal flora of the human mouth, gastrointestinal tract, and female genital tract, where they produce lactic acid (resulting in a low vaginal pH) and competitively inhibit pathogenic organisms.
